TD JazzFest 2026: KOKOROKO

Royal Theatre 805 Broughton Street, Victoria, BC, Canada

London UK-based septet Kokoroko—founded in 2014 by trumpeter/flugelhornist Sheila Maurice-Grey and percussionist Onome Edgeworth—draws on West African roots to fuse Afrobeat, highlife, and funk into entrancing, genre-leaping grooves, showcased on their 2025 album Tuff Times Never Last as they make their Victoria debut at TD JazzFest 2026.
